About the Role In this dynamic and fast-paced role, you will play a key part in delivering exceptional repair services to our customers across Haringey.  You will be responsible for managing diaries for a specific trade, ensuring that resources are utilised efficiently and that services are delivered in a timely manner. Working closely with a small, collaborative team, you’ll plan and schedule tasks based on operational requirements and service level agreements, keeping things running smoothly. Clear and effective communication with customers is essential, ensuring they are informed about planned works and promptly notified of any necessary changes.
